Hirejobs Canada
Register
Auckland Jobs
Canterbury Jobs
Northland Jobs
Otago Jobs
Southland Jobs
Tasman Jobs
Wellington Jobs
West Coast Jobs
Oil & Gas Jobs
Banking Jobs
Construction Jobs
Top Management Jobs
IT - Software Jobs
Medical Healthcare Jobs
Purchase / Logistics Jobs
Sales
Ajax Jobs
Designing Jobs
ASP .NET Jobs
Java Jobs
MySQL Jobs
Sap hr Jobs
Software Testing Jobs
Html Jobs
IT Jobs
Logistics Jobs
Customer Service Jobs
Airport Jobs
Banking Jobs
Driver Jobs
Part Time Jobs
Civil Engineering Jobs
Accountant Jobs
Safety Officer Jobs
Nursing Jobs
Civil Engineering Jobs
Hospitality Jobs
Part Time Jobs
Security Jobs
Finance Jobs
Marketing Jobs
Shipping Jobs
Real Estate Jobs
Telecom Jobs

Senior Full Stack Software Developer (C#) - Jobs in Montréal

Job LocationMontréal
EducationNot Mentioned
Salary$90,000 - 110,000 per year
IndustryNot Mentioned
Functional AreaNot Mentioned
Job TypeFull Time

Job Description

DescriptionEDGE10 Group is perfecting human performance. We provide the world’s leading health, performance and physical testing platform to organisations around the world, empowering them with actionable insights, leading to efficient, high-quality decision making.As market leader, we work with organisations across the medical and performance spectrums, from elite to grass root teams and from armed forces to multi-national corporations. In sport alone, we work with 1,000+ teams from the leading and most prestigious leagues around such as the MLB, NHL, EPL, MLS and more.RequirementsRequirementsWe’re recruiting for a senior software developer to join our Montreal team and help improve our existing suite of products for the professional sports industry.We’re looking for someone skilled in both front-end and .Net back-end web development with a collaborative attitude and a desire to learn. We operate in an agile environment and focus on creating high-quality applications. As the company is expanding, we’re looking for adaptable people who want to grow as opportunities arise.You’ll work with our sports science consultants and customers to develop new features, support existing features, and improve application reliability and performance.You should have

  • 5-7 years of professional development experience
  • Experience with the Microsoft stack including C#, .Net and SQL
  • Experience with front-end technologies and frameworks
  • Experience with test-driven and agile development practices
  • Experience with backlog management tools (Azure DevOps, Jira or similar)
  • Experience with CI/CD (Azure DevOps, TeamCity, Bitbucket Pipelines or similar)
  • Ability to articulate ideas of clean, logical code to SOLID principles
  • A degree in Computer Science or related field, or have equivalent professional experience
  • A curiosity and love of learning and a high attention to detail and quality
  • Ability to communicate clearly and concisely
Ability to help mentor more junior developersWe work primarily with the following technologies. We don’t expect people to know all these immediately, but we’d like to see a desire to learn the following:
    • C# .NET/.Net Core, MVC, WebAPI (Required)
    • SQL Server (Required)
    • Database deployment tools and automation (SSDT/SQL Deploy/SQL Source Control)
    • Entity Framework / EF Core
    • Azure / Azure DevOps
    BenefitsWhat we offerWith our company values including ‘We strive for great, not good’, we are committed to hiring the best candidates and reward accordingly.
    • Opportunity to contribute to the technical direction of the EDGE10 Group
    • Fast-paced work environment with creative freedom to implement your ideas
    • Collaboration with recognized thought leaders making a real impact in this ever-evolving industry
    • Exciting working atmosphere in an ambitious, diverse, and agile team
    • Internal knowledge sharing forums, best-practice sharing and continuous learning
    Benefits
    • Holiday Allowance: 20 days
    • EDGE10 Group Bonus Scheme: employees can earn up to 40% of their salary in stock options. The scheme is subject to change and termsamp; conditions
    • Private Health insurance: Comprehensive health insurance with Desjardins insurance.
    • Flexible Working Policy: we operate a flexible working policy that allows for a balanced working from home policy and/or remote working. This varies from office to office
    • Personal Development Plans: each employee has an individual personal development plan that sits alongside their KPIs
    • Long Term Service Awards: employees are eligible for awards after 5amp; 10 years of service and every 5-year anniversary after that
    • Volunteering days: each employee will be entitled to paid leave to undertake volunteering work
    We are looking for exceptional people. If you believe you can add value to the company and continue to drive it forward, apply now.We are looking for exceptional people. If you believe you can add value to the company and continue to drive it forward, apply now.We love what we do. We want you too as well.

    APPLY NOW

    © 2021 HireJobsCanada All Rights Reserved